OverviewIn Bonding with God, Victor Counted uses the attachment framework to explore how we develop psychological bonds with God, what sustains those bonds, and what can erode them, leading to a crisis of faith. As we navigate questions of identity, meaning, and purpose, the role of faith in offering support and guidance becomes crucial. Yet the emotional and psychological aspects of religious experience are often overlooked. Counted fills this gap by showing how a caregiving faith can foster resilience and spiritual transformation.
